题目内容

【题目】定义[x]表示不超过x的最大整数,,例如:.执行如图所示的程序框图若输入的,则输出结果为(

A.-4.6B.-2.8C.-1.4D.-2.6

【答案】D

【解析】

由已知的程序框图可以知道:该程序的功能是利用循环结构计算并输出变量z的值,模拟程序的运行过程,分析循环中各变量值的变化情况,可得答案.

模拟程序的运行,可得x=6.8y=6-1.6=4.4x=6-1=5;满足条件x≥0,执行循环体,x=2.2y=2-0.4=1.6x=2-1=1;满足条件x≥0,执行循环体,x= 0.8y=0-1.6=1.6x=0-1=-1;不满足条件x≥0,退出循环,z=-1+(-1.6)=-2.6,则输出z的值为-2.6.

故选:D.

练习册系列答案
相关题目

违法和不良信息举报电话:027-86699610 举报邮箱:58377363@163.com

精英家教网